Gartcosh station is equipped with essential facilities to ensure your journey begins without a hitch. While there is no ticket office, rest assured that ticket machines are present on-site, allowing you to purchase or collect tickets with convenience. For those requiring assistance, there are help points available, although there is no staff assistance provided. The commitment to accessibility is evident with step-free access across both platforms and dedicated Blue Badge parking spaces.
The station car park, operated by ScotRail, offers 97 spaces and remains open throughout the week, free of charge. Unfortunately, the station is not equipped with refreshment or shopping facilities, so it’s advisable to plan accordingly. For travelers with bicycles, there are stands available to ensure your two-wheeled companions are safely stored while you journey by rail.

Nestled in the scenic Powys region of Wales, Llangammarch train station offers a unique charm that's hard to find anywhere else. This quaint station caters to those looking for a peaceful getaway from bustling city life. As a vital stop on the Heart of Wales Line, it provides an essential link between rural communities and larger urban areas. Planning a trip to or from Llangammarch? Let us guide you through what to expect at this modest yet important station.
Llangammarch station is unstaffed, which means there’s no ticket office or ticket machines available. It's important to plan ahead and purchase your tickets online if you’re starting your journey here. Although smartcards and validators are not an option at this station, an induction loop is present for those requiring auditory assistance. The absence of other amenities like waiting rooms, toilets, and refreshment facilities hints at the station's minimalistic setup. Nevertheless, there is a seating area where you can take a breather while waiting for your train. For those who drive, the car park maintained by Transport for Wales offers four spaces and one accessible option, free of charge.
The station provides step-free access to the platform via a slight slope from the car park, categorized as B1, offering some accessibility to travelers with reduced mobility. While it lacks facilities such as accessible toilets or ticket machines, the platform is accessible and there is a ramp available for train access. For assistance, it's recommended to arrange for support in advance through the Passenger Assist service, ensuring a smooth journey for those requiring extra help.
Although Llangammarch Station doesn’t offer local bike hire or storage, it does provide essential links for onward travel. The rail replacement bus service stops at the station entrance, offering an alternative means of travel during any rail service disruptions.
